About Alzada Elem

Alzada Elem is a thinly populated public-school district in Montana. The district runs 1 schools and teaches approximately 8 students.

On a per-school basis, Alzada Elem runs about 8 students per campus, 95% below the state mean of roughly 175.

Five-year track record. Total public-school enrollment in Alzada Elem has expanded 167% since SY 2017-18, moving from about 3 students to 8. The White share of public-school enrollment contracted from 100% to 88%.
